Wages • Coal Mining and the Victorians • MyLearning

Wages. Although mining was hard work and dangerous, compared with other manual jobs working underground was relatively well paid. Families would work together in a team and the amount of money they earned depended on how much coal they brought up to the surface. Chart Illustrating 1842 Commissioners' Findings into Wages.

Mining | Tennessee Encyclopedia Mining | Tennessee Encyclopedia

Mining | Tennessee Encyclopedia

Oct 08, 2017 · Copper mining in the Volunteer State began in the middle of the nineteenth century in the DucktownCopperhill district, commonly known as the Copper Basin, of Polk County. The mineral was first discovered in the area in the 1840s. The Hiwassee Mine opened in 1850 and became the first deep underground mine. By 1864 there were fourteen mines.

Underground Coal Mining Disasters and Fatalities ...

Coal Mining Disasters, . During, a total of 11,606 underground coal mine workers died in 513 underground coal mining disasters* ( Figure ), with most disasters resulting from explosion or fire ( Table ). In 1907 alone, 692 miners died in four mine explosions in West ia, Pennsylvania, and Alabama ( 6 ).
